#TokyoGoldRush | Russell through, Nugent, Whyte disqualified in Women's 400m hurdles
Published:Friday | July 30, 2021 | 10:32 PM
National champion Janieve Russell is through to the Women's 400m hurdles semi-finals at the Tokyo Olympics on Friday night (Jamaica time).
Russell clocked 54.81 seconds to finish second behind Ukraine's Anna Ryzhykova (54.56s), while Paulien Couckuyt clocked a Belgian record of 54.90s for third.
Jamaica's Leah Nugent, however, was disqualified from her heat for a lane violation while her compatriot Ronda Whyte was put out of her heat after a false start.
World record holder Sydney McLaughlin (54.65s) of the USA and her compatriot Dalilah Muhammad (53.97s) are the other medal hopefuls to qualify.
